Background and Interest

From learning in a theoretically mathematical world in the past, I turned myself to enter the application world. I am currently a PhD student at the Mathematics for Real-World Systems Centre for Doctoral Training (MathSys II CDT). I have broad interests covering Operational Research, Data Science and Machine Learning. My current work is focused on Multi-armed bandit and Ranking&Selection problems.
